The CNMIA said that polycrystalline silicon is being priced at an average ofCNY 215.2/kg, with prices ranging from CNY 198/kg to CNY 230/kg, up 31.22% from mid-January. After China's recent new year holiday, wafer manufacturers returned to high operation rates in order to handle downstream orders.
Monocrystalline silicon currently sells at an average price ofCNY 217.5 ($32.30)/kg, with prices ranging from CNY 200/kg to CNY 232/kg. This is 31.02% higher that the levels registered in mid-January.
Based on a specific silicon consumption of 3.1 grams per watt, the polysilicon price rose from 3.4 $Ct/W to 5.0 $Ct/W in the first quarter. Its share in the solar module price grew from 16% to 23%.

By Johannes Bernreuter, Head of Bernreuter Research Within just one quarter, the spot price for solar-grade polysilicon soared by nearly 50% – from US$11 per kg in early January to more than $16/kg at the end of March, the highest level since June 2018. How did this rapid increase come about?
Polysilicon prices have increased since the start of the year, after a relatively long period of decline in the latter months of 2022, according to the silicon branch of the CNMIA. With a specific silicon consumption of 14 grams per watt (g/W) and a spot price of $28/kg, polysilicon made up costs of $0.39/W or 12.6% of the average wholesale solar module price ($3.10/W) in 2003. Polycrystalline silicon is the key feedstock in the crystalline silicon based photovoltaic industry and used for the production of conventional solar cells.For the first time, in 2006, over half of the world''s supply of polysilicon was being used by PV manufacturers.
